示例#1
0
        private void tmEdit_Click(object sender, EventArgs e)
        {
            if (tvType.SelectedNode.Parent == null)
            {
                return;
            }
            string strSQL = "select * from t_Class where F_ID = '" + tvType.SelectedNode.Tag.ToString() + "'";

            DataLib.DataHelper myHelper = new DataLib.DataHelper();
            DataSet            ds       = myHelper.GetDs(strSQL);

            if (ds.Tables[0].Rows.Count == 0)
            {
                return;
            }
            //TreeNode Node = GetFactory(tvType.SelectedNode);
            frmTypeEdit myTypeEdit = new frmTypeEdit();

            //myTypeEdit.strFactory = Node.Tag.ToString();
            myTypeEdit.strPID         = tvType.SelectedNode.Parent.Tag.ToString();
            myTypeEdit.strCID         = tvType.SelectedNode.Tag.ToString();
            myTypeEdit.textEdit3.Text = ds.Tables[0].Rows[0]["F_Name"].ToString();
            ds.Dispose();
            myTypeEdit.ShowDialog();
            myTypeEdit.Dispose();
        }
示例#2
0
        private void tmAdd_Click(object sender, EventArgs e)
        {
            //TreeNode Node = GetFactory(tvType.SelectedNode);

            frmTypeEdit myTypeEdit = new frmTypeEdit();

            //myTypeEdit.strFactory = Node.Tag.ToString();
            myTypeEdit.strPID   = tvType.SelectedNode.Tag.ToString();
            myTypeEdit.strTable = strTable;
            myTypeEdit.strKey   = strKey;
            myTypeEdit.ShowDialog();
            myTypeEdit.Dispose();
        }